There is a fine line between playing the game wrong (IE: Not using a skill at all) and not playing up to your standards (Not using a skill as often as you think it should be used despite victory)



The main issue is that people want to get the content done. It is better to just carry the bad than trying to reform them. Funny story - I got few times scolded for explaining skills and rotations. Players just want to end the suffering as fast as possible, without thinking about the possibility of meeting the underperforming player again in the future.
As evil as it may sound I would like to see the duty finder matching players of similar skill together, just for a week or two, as the "feedback" on the forums would be really interesting to read.
